1. 程式人生 > >GUI是什麼

GUI是什麼

GUI是什麼
1.GUI是什麼–簡介
  GUI的全稱為Graphical User Interface,圖形化介面或圖形使用者介面,是指採用圖形方式顯示的計算機操作環境使用者介面。與早期計算機使用的命令列介面相比,圖形介面對於使用者來說更為簡便易用。GUI的廣泛應用是當今計算機發展的重大成就之一,它極大地方便了非專業使用者的使用人們從此不再需要死記硬背大量的命令,取而代之的是通過視窗、選單、按鍵等方式來方便地進行操作。而嵌入式GUI具有下面幾個方面的基本要求:輕型、佔用資源少、高效能、高可靠性、便於移植、可配置等特點。

2.GUI是什麼–組成
  圖形使用者介面是一種人與計算機通訊的介面顯示格式,允許使用者使用滑鼠等輸入裝置操縱螢幕上的圖示或選單選項,以選擇命令、呼叫檔案、啟動程式或執行其它一些日常任務。GUI的組成部分主要分為以下幾部分:

桌面—在啟動時顯示,也是介面中最底層,有時也指代包括視窗、檔案瀏覽器在內的“桌面環境”。一般的介面中,桌面上放有各種應用程式和資料的圖示,使用者可以依此開始工作。

視窗—應用程式為使用資料而在圖形使用者介面中設定的基本單元。應用程式和資料在視窗內實現一體化。在視窗中,使用者可以在視窗中操作應用程式,進行資料的管理、生成和編輯。

單一檔案介面—在視窗中,一個數據在一個視窗內完成的方式。若要在其他應用程式的視窗使用資料,將相應生成新的視窗。因此視窗數量多,管理複雜。

多檔案介面—在一個視窗之內進行多個數據管理的方式。這種情況下,視窗的管理簡單化,但是操作變為雙重管理。

標籤—多檔案介面的資料管理方式中使用的一種介面,將資料的標題在視窗中並排,通過選擇標籤標題顯示必要的資料,這樣使得接入資料方式變得更為便捷。

選單—將系統可以執行的命令以階層的方式顯示出來的一個介面。一般置於畫面的最上方或者最下方,應用程式能使用的所有命令幾乎全部都能放入。重要程度一般是從左到右,越往右重要度越低。

按鈕—選單中,利用程度高的命令用圖形表示出來,配置在應用程式中,成為按鈕。

3.GUI是什麼–實現方法
  針對特定的圖形裝置輸出介面,自行開發相關的功能函式。購買針對特定嵌入式系統的圖形中間軟體包。採用原始碼開放的嵌入式GUI系統。使用獨立軟體開發商提供的嵌入式GUI產品。

實現GUI介面的準則主要包括:減少使用者的認知負擔、保持介面的一致性、滿足不同目標使用者的創意需求、使用者介面友好性、圖示識別平衡性、圖示功能的一致性、建立介面與使用者的互動交流等。

4.GUI是什麼–用途
  GUI的廣泛應用是當今計算機發展的重大成就之一,它極大地方便了非專業使用者的使用。人們從此不再需要死記硬背大量的命令,取而代之的是可以通過視窗、選單、按鍵等方式來方便地進行操作。主要用於手機通訊移動產品、電腦操作平臺、軟體產品、PDA產品、數碼產品、車載系統產品、智慧家電產品、遊戲產品、產品的線上推廣等領域。